Constantius II. Follis. 325-326 AD. Cyzicus. (Ric-Unlisted). (Tesorillo-Constancio II 59, Plate Coin). Anv.: FL IVL CONSTANTIVS NOB C, laureate, draped and cuirassed bust to left. Rev.: ROVIDENTIAE AVGG, camp gate with no doors, two turrets, star above; SMKB• in exergue. Bi. 2,95 g. The specimen presented shows the obverse of the Ric-VII 38 type combined with the reverse of the Ric-VII 34, p. 647. Extremely rare. Not in Ric, Plate Coin. VF/XF. Est...100,00.
